A while back i put forth ideas i was having for a grow room and found alot of flaws in my design. Im hoping that I have since fixed those flaws. If anyone can please tell me any doubts or worries you might have about my grow room design it would be appreciated!

Grow room is about 4X4X7 feet

Lights (HPS 950 Watt)
Two 250 Watt HPS lights up above
Three 150 watt HPS lights at ground level shining on lower leaves
Reflective Garage door insulation on walls floor and roof


Heat
Each 250 watt HPS is in a cooling tube (/6 inch inline fan for exhaust) The cooling tubes lead up through a dropped roof in the top of the closet, and eventually into the attic.

One 6 inch inline fan for intake. The intake is coming from another room kept at 65-75F and does not blow near the plants

One fan /Air purifier

Odor
1 DIY carbon filter
https://www.rollitup.org/indoor-growing/7074-easy-build-diy-carbon-filter.html
1 DIY Ozone generator
http://www.ehow.com/way_5463718_diy-ozone-generator.html
1 decent air purifier (UV and ION)
All exhaust fans pull through DIY carbon filters attached at the intake of the cool tubes

Humidity
1 humidifier with a humidity gauge to keep room at 50%

Legalities
No walls of the grow room are on an exterior wall
Nothing bought or built was bought with cash
Live alone

Ventilation (112 sq foot room)
Two 6 inch inline fans (160cfm) for exhaust (through the cool tubes)
6 inch inline fan for intake (160cfm)

Everything is on timers!
Growing 3-5 white widows
Veging till 18 inches

Yeah, selling everything would be a pain unless you already have a buyer for your gear. It's worth it to upgrade though. I'll attach a char that shows what I'm talking about. If you have air cooled lights they're probably about 12" away from the tops of the tallest plants. A 250 watt light at that distance creates 8754 lumens. Adding more of the same light won't multiply the amount of lumes per bulb. What it will do is increase your ability to cover a larger square footage, just with a lower amount of light.

If you were running a single 1000 watt at 12" you would be putting off 44,563 lumens vs 8,754 lumens. Just make sure you get a reflector big enough to cover your area. That extra light will give you bigger, higher quality buds ultimately. It will also shorten your flowering time some.
